Theres an adjustment on the rod from the carb to governor that affects the idle surge you have. Disconnect the rod at the carb, then Pull the throttle lever all the way back. When the carb is at idle the end of the rod should be a half hole off. You should have to pull the rod forward against the spring pressure to get it in the hole. If it just drops in the hole it will surge at idle. You can google this procedure. Its listed on a lot of JD forums. Your governor isnt sticking. It worked just fine when you hit the shed. If it was stuck, the engine would stall every time you engage the clutch in gear or try to drive through a shed(sorry couldnt help it). I have a 46 B, 51 BN and a 40 A. Have done the same things you have done and had the same issues. Good luck!

I know I'm walking into the middle of a project. I have only watched this video. All that smoke from the compression release and the exhaust. Oil or fuel? It looks fuel to me. How full is the crankcase? More than one person has put five gallons of fuel into the crankcase because of a stuck float. I didn't see you adjust the low speed needle. My theory is your low speed circuit is either set wrong or functioning wrong. Idle drops, governor calls for throttle. Power circuit dumps fuel. You get a hunting idle. I believe your governor is fine. I believe your timing is fine. Glad you are ok. There are only about four people I will let run any of my hand clutch machines.
